Description

Can you recognise the difference between horse behaviours triggered by pain, discomfort, environmental stimuli, or confusion in training systems? Join Trudi Dempsey, an IAABC Certified Horse Behavior Consultant and ABTC Accredited Animal Behaviourist, for an in-depth study of the Equine Discomfort Ethogram. This course will help you interpret horse behaviours and postures. You will also learn to distinguish behaviours that might be addressed with behaviour modification from those that suggest the need for further diagnostic procedures. This knowledge can contribute to improved wellbeing in horses. During this 4-week, instructor-led course, students will: Examine the value of the ethogram in supporting best welfare Interpret pain behaviours and postures Work through case studies to evaluate the core principles of the ethogram Use this knowledge to inform clients, colleagues, and students
